RENAULT ARKANA

Buyer's Guide & Data from our Checks
The Renault Arkana is a stylish and practical SUV that has gained popularity in the UK market since its introduction in 2021. Its design blends the sleek lines of a coupe with the versatility of an SUV, making it a versatile choice for drivers seeking both style and practicality. With over 3,100 checks on mycarcheck.com, it’s clear that the Renault Arkana is a relatively common sight on UK roads, especially among families and commuters looking for a reliable, all-round vehicle.
Typically used for daily commuting, family outings, and longer journeys, the Renault Arkana is well-suited for those seeking a comfortable and economical car. It offers a good balance of fuel efficiency, with most examples averaging around 9,000 miles annually, and low ownership turnover, with just about a quarter of owners changing cars more than once. Its reputation for reliability, combined with the appealing design and features, makes it a popular choice for first-time buyers and anyone valuing a sophisticated but practical vehicle.
What sets the Renault Arkana apart in its class is its unique coupe-inspired silhouette paired with practical SUV features. Known for its value, with an average private sale price of around £20,900, and its reputation for dependability, the Arkana is often compared favorably to rivals like the Nissan Qashqai and Kia Niro. It’s regarded as a model that offers a stylish drive without sacrificing everyday usability, making it a notable contender in the urban and family SUV market.
